Electrochemical pH/ORP Controller with Calibration Features
A precise Digital pH/ORP controller is an essential tool for any laboratory or industrial setting requiring precise monitoring and control of pH levels. These controllers often include advanced calibration capabilities that ensure ongoing accuracy and reliable readings. The mechanism for calibration typically involves adjusting the controller's parameters using known standards. By periodically verifying your pH/ORP controller, you can maximize the quality and accuracy of your measurements.
A well-calibrated controller optimizes the overall performance of your system by providing reliable readings that support informed decisions. This is particularly important in applications where even slight fluctuations in pH or ORP can have a significant impact on the outcome.
Accurate pH/ORP Control for Industrial Processes
In industrial settings, accurate pH and ORP control is vital for ensuring optimal operational performance. Deviations in these parameters can lead to undesirablereactions, affecting productivity and potentially jeopardizing safety. Modern industrial processes often utilize sophisticated control systems that employ advanced technologies to maintain pH and ORP within narrow tolerances.
- Advanced sensors
- Process automation software
- Continuous monitoring
These technologies enable precise pH/ORP regulation, reducing the risk of failures. By controlling pH and ORP parameters, industries can maximize their process efficiency while maintaining a safe and predictable operating environment.

Robust pH/ORP Controller for Water Treatment
Ensuring optimal water quality is paramount in various industries. A high-performance pH/ORP controller serves as an indispensable tool for precisely regulating the acidity or alkalinity and redox potential of water. These controllers utilize advanced probe to continuously measure these critical parameters, triggering adjustments as needed. The result is a stable and reliable water environment essential for efficient operations.
- Critical characteristics of a high-performance pH/ORP controller include:
- Accurate sensor technology for reliable readings
- Intuitive interfaces for easy operation and configuration
- Programmable control algorithms for precise pH/ORP adjustment
- Durable construction to withstand harsh settings
By optimizing water quality, these controllers contribute to better outcomes and minimal expenditures.
